Since opening their very first restaurant in Barcelona, more than 25 years ago now, brothers and chefs Iñaki and Mikel López de Viñaspre have been taking the dishes of their Basque grandmothers beyond their own homes; Sagardi now has several locations worldwide, including in Madrid, Valencia, Barcelona, Buenos Aires, Porto, London and Amsterdam (on Spuistraat).

Caesar’s mushroom
Mikel has come to Amsterdam especially to prepare Basque autumn dishes behind the stove. Meat is not on the menu this time, because Sagardi is much more than a meat restaurant. Exhibit A: the first dish of Caesar’s mushroom, a relative of porcini (also known as the Caesar’s mushroom), finely chopped on toast. This toast is homemade sourdough bread that has been fermented in the oven for 48 hours. It is so delicious!
This special mushroom owes its name to the fact that it was highly prized by the emperors of Rome. They sent mycologists (fungus researchers) into the forest to point out exactly where the Caesar’s mushrooms could be found.

The texture of the Caesar’s mushroom is both firm and delicate at the same time, a little like the texture of an apricot. You can taste that very clearly in the dish in which the bolete is cut into larger pieces, grilled and served with pigeon jus and egg yolk. We drink typical Basque wine Txakolina with it; juicy white fruit, minerals and fresh acidity—very delicious.
Piquillo peppers
Another delicious vegetable dish is the fresh, hand-picked “piquillo” peppers, grilled over a wood fire. The flesh of this ‘star among peppers’ is red and sweet, and then: grilled, peeled and caramelized in the oven. Oil over it, salt—fantastic!


Black beans with lardo
A true comfort-food dish is the plate of black beans. It is served with blood sausage, lardo (back fat from the Italian Cinta Senese pig) and cabbage. You can place these on the beans yourself and then finish every bite with a fresh (not spicy) pepper. Incredibly delicious!
